@tonycawley69 wrote:
So what solution do you propose? They're clearly doing everything they can.

Easiest and fastest solution would be a simple 2-Step-Verification with your Phonenumber.

Most cheaters in the world don´t have "unlimited" phonenumbers to use on a daily basis.

If devs don´t have time, money or experience to code one on their own, then just partner with google auth like ubisoft does.

 

Once this would be implemented it would buy them some time to implement a different anticheat which is still needed (at best 2 anticheat with different methods like Fairfight+Battleye)

 

 

And this is something a lot of us already asked for after the first week of release.
